Well, I think I have the install working, but I have a
small lingering concern:

# /etc/init.d/clamav start
Starting Antivirus database update daemon.
Starting Antivirus daemon.
Starting E-mail scanner.
/usr/local/sbin/clamav-milter: (-q && !LogSyslog):
warning - all interception message methods are off
/usr/local/sbin/clamav-milter: --max-children must be
given if --external is not given
/etc/init.d/clamav stop

Now, I have not been able to find anything in
clamd.conf or freshclam.conf that would indicate
anything about specifying children.  Additionally, I'm
not sure what '!LogSyslog' is referring to?

Anyways /var/log/clamd showed the following when I
tried starting up 0851:
